117.info
人生若只如初见

ZigBee协议栈介绍

ZigBee协议栈是一种无线通信协议栈,主要用于低功耗、短距离的物联网(IoT)应用。它基于IEEE 802.15.4标准,提供了一种可靠、安全、低功耗的无线通信解决方案。

ZigBee协议栈由3个主要层组成:

  1. 应用层:应用层负责定义和管理应用程序在网络中的行为。它提供了各种应用协议,如家庭自动化、能源管理、智能照明等。应用层可以通过ZigBee设备对象(ZDO)与其他设备通信。

  2. 网络层:网络层负责设备之间的路由和组网功能。它使用自适应路由算法来确定最佳路径,并确保数据包的可靠传输。网络层还负责设备的加入和离开过程,以及网络拓扑的管理。

  3. 物理层和MAC层:物理层和MAC层提供了无线通信的基本功能,如频率选择、信道访问、数据传输和错误检测。物理层负责将数据转换为无线信号,并在接收端将无线信号转换为数据。MAC层负责管理网络中的设备,协调信道访问,并提供冲突检测和重传机制。

除了上述三个主要层外,ZigBee协议栈还包括安全层,用于提供数据的加密和认证,以确保通信的安全性和可靠性。

总的来说,ZigBee协议栈是一种适用于低功耗、短距离的物联网应用的通信协议栈,通过提供可靠的通信、灵活的路由和安全的数据传输,为各种物联网应用提供了一种可靠的解决方案。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fe530AzsLBA5fDFI.html

推荐文章

  • Zigbee无线通信原理

    Zigbee是一种低功耗、短距离、自组织网络的无线通信技术。它基于IEEE 802.15.4标准,主要应用于物联网、智能家居和工业自动化等领域。
    Zigbee的无线通信原理...

  • zigbee协议栈能支持哪些网络拓扑

    ZigBee协议栈支持的网络拓扑主要有星型、树型和**网状(Mesh)**三种。以下是它们的特点和应用场景:
    星型拓扑 特点:所有节点(终端设备)都直接连接到一个...

  • zigbee协议栈有哪些应用案例

    ZigBee协议栈是一种基于IEEE 802.15.4标准的低功耗无线通信协议,广泛应用于智能家居、工业自动化、智能农业等多个领域。以下是zigbee协议栈的应用案例: 智能家...

  • zigbee协议栈能支持哪些传输速率

    ZigBee协议栈支持多种传输速率,具体取决于其工作频段。以下是不同频段下的传输速率: 2.4GHz频段:最高数据速率可达250kbps。
    868MHz频段:最高数据速率可...

  • Windows 更新独立安装程序的说明

    要更新Windows独立安装程序,可以按照以下步骤进行操作: 打开Windows更新设置:点击开始菜单,然后选择“设置”图标。在设置窗口中,点击“更新和安全”选项。 ...

  • 什么是系统可用性

    系统可用性是指系统在规定时间内能够正常运行的能力。系统可用性是衡量系统的稳定性和可靠性的重要指标。一个可用性高的系统意味着系统能够以较高的概率在需要时...

  • windows关闭端口方法

    要关闭Windows上的端口,您可以使用以下方法: 使用Windows防火墙: 打开控制面板,找到“Windows Defender 防火墙”选项。 点击“高级设置”。 在左侧面板中选择...

  • 电脑定时开机方法

    电脑定时开机的方法可以通过操作系统的定时任务来实现。下面是Windows和Mac系统的操作步骤:
    Windows系统: 打开控制面板,点击“系统和安全”,然后点击“...